dc.description.abstract | Code-coverage-based testing is a widely-used testing strategy with the aim of providing a meaningful decision criterion for the adequacy of a test suite. Code-coverage-based testing is also used for the development of safety-critical applications, as the modified condition/decision coverage (MCDC) is proposed by the DO178b document. One critical issue of code-coverage testing is that they are typically applied to source code while the generated machine code may result in a different code structure due to code optimizations performed by an compiler. In this work we describe the automatic calculation of coverage profiles describing which structural code-coverage criteria are preserved by which code optimization. These coverage profiles allow to easily extend compilers with the feature of preserving any given code-coverage criteria by enabling only those code optimizations that preserve it. | en |
